ROOFS svela i segreti dei dati biomedici complessi
Una nuova frontiera nella selezione delle feature per biomarcatori e oltre

Intelligenza artificiale
L'importanza della selezione delle feature nei dati biomedici
Nel vasto e complesso panorama dei dati biomedici, l'identificazione delle caratteristiche più informative è cruciale. La ricerca di biomarcatori, ad esempio, richiede metodi capaci di discernere segnali deboli ma significativi all'interno di matrici di dati ad altissima dimensionalità.
Tecniche tradizionali spesso faticano a gestire la complessità intrinseca di questi dataset, portando a risultati subottimali o fuorvianti. È qui che entra in gioco l'importanza di approcci robusti come ROOFS.
Questo pacchetto Python è stato progettato specificamente per affrontare queste sfide, offrendo un framework per la selezione di feature che non solo è efficace, ma anche resiliente a rumore e artefatti comuni nei dati biologici. La capacità di isolare le variabili predittive più affidabili è fondamentale per accelerare la scoperta di nuove terapie e migliorare la diagnostica.
Senza una selezione accurata, il rischio di identificare falsi positivi o di trascurare correlazioni importanti aumenta esponenzialmente, minando l'affidabilità dell'intera ricerca. Comprendere come funzionano questi algoritmi è il primo passo per sfruttarne appieno il potenziale.
ROOFS: un approccio robusto alla selezione delle feature
ROOFS, acronimo di RObust biOmarker Feature Selection, rappresenta un avanzamento significativo nel campo dell'analisi dei dati biomedici. Il suo nucleo algoritmico si basa su principi di robustezza, progettati per minimizzare l'impatto di outlier e dati mancanti, problemi frequenti in contesti clinici reali.
A differenza di metodi più sensibili alle specificità del campione, ROOFS mira a identificare un insieme di feature che mantengano la loro rilevanza predittiva attraverso diverse coorti di pazienti o condizioni sperimentali. Questo approccio garantisce una maggiore generalizzabilità dei risultati, un aspetto fondamentale quando si mira all'identificazione di biomarcatori clinicamente validi.
La sua implementazione in Python lo rende facilmente accessibile a ricercatori e data scientist, permettendo un'integrazione fluida nei workflow di analisi esistenti. La selezione di caratteristiche affidabili è il primo passo per costruire modelli predittivi accurati e interpretabili, essenziali per la traslazione clinica delle scoperte scientifiche.
L'efficacia di ROOFS risiede nella sua capacità di navigare la complessità dei dati, fornendo una base solida per future indagini.
Oltre i biomarcatori: applicazioni in neuropsicologia
Sebbene ROOFS sia stato sviluppato con un focus primario sulla ricerca di biomarcatori, i suoi principi metodologici offrono un valore considerevole anche in altri ambiti della ricerca biomedica, inclusa la neuropsicologia clinica. La valutazione dei deficit cognitivi, ad esempio, spesso comporta l'analisi di un ampio spettro di test e misure comportamentali.
Identificare quali di queste misure siano effettivamente predittive di specifiche condizioni neurologiche o psichiatriche è una sfida analoga a quella della ricerca di biomarcatori. ROOFS può aiutare a distinguere i sintomi cognitivi chiave da quelli secondari o non specifici, fornendo una visione più chiara del profilo neuropsicologico del paziente.
Questo può portare a diagnosi più precise e a piani di trattamento personalizzati. La capacità di gestire dati ad alta dimensionalità è particolarmente utile quando si integrano dati provenienti da diverse fonti, come test neuropsicologici, neuroimaging e dati genetici.
L'applicazione di questi metodi avanzati apre nuove prospettive per comprendere e trattare le disfunzioni cerebrali, collegando la potenza dell'IA alla pratica clinica.
Come ROOFS gestisce la complessità dei dati
La gestione della dimensionalità e della complessità nei dataset biomedici è una sfida centrale. ROOFS affronta questo problema attraverso una combinazione di tecniche statistiche avanzate e un'architettura algoritmica robusta.
Il pacchetto è progettato per operare efficacemente anche quando il numero di feature (variabili misurate) supera di gran lunga il numero di campioni (pazienti o osservazioni). Questo scenario, noto come 'high-dimensional data', è la norma in campi come la genomica, la proteomica e, appunto, la neuropsicologia.
ROOFS impiega metodi che non solo selezionano le feature più rilevanti, ma lo fanno in modo da ridurre la sensibilità a fluttuazioni casuali o a specificità del campione. Questo si traduce in una maggiore affidabilità dei risultati ottenuti, rendendo le scoperte più solide e replicabili.
La sua architettura modulare permette inoltre potenziali estensioni future, adattandosi a nuove tipologie di dati o a requisiti analitici emergenti. Comprendere come ROOFS gestisce questi aspetti è fondamentale per chiunque lavori con dati biomedici complessi e desideri ottenere insight significativi.
Il ruolo dell'IA nella scoperta di biomarcatori
L'Intelligenza Artificiale (IA) sta rivoluzionando la scoperta di biomarcatori, trasformando radicalmente il modo in cui analizziamo dati complessi. Pacchetti come ROOFS sono un esempio tangibile di come gli algoritmi di machine learning possano essere applicati per estrarre informazioni preziose da enormi set di dati.
L'IA permette di identificare pattern sottili e correlazioni non lineari che sfuggirebbero all'analisi umana tradizionale. Questo è particolarmente vero nell'identificazione di biomarcatori per malattie complesse, dove l'interazione di molteplici fattori biologici contribuisce al fenotipo della malattia.
L'IA può aiutare a modellare queste interazioni complesse, portando alla scoperta di nuovi indicatori diagnostici o prognostici. Inoltre, l'IA facilita l'integrazione di dati multimodali – genomici, proteomici, clinici, di imaging – creando un quadro più olistico della biologia della malattia.
Questo approccio integrato è essenziale per sviluppare una medicina di precisione efficace. La continua evoluzione degli algoritmi di IA promette ulteriori progressi in questo campo.
Sfide e opportunità nella neuropsicologia computazionale
La neuropsicologia computazionale rappresenta un campo interdisciplinare in rapida crescita, che fonde principi della neuropsicologia, informatica e scienza dei dati. L'obiettivo è sviluppare modelli computazionali per comprendere meglio le funzioni cerebrali e i disturbi cognitivi.
L'applicazione di strumenti come ROOFS in questo contesto apre scenari entusiasmanti. Ad esempio, nell'analisi di dati di neuroimaging funzionale (fMRI) o elettroencefalografia (EEG), dove la dimensionalità è estremamente elevata, metodi robusti di selezione delle feature sono indispensabili.
ROOFS può aiutare a identificare le regioni cerebrali o i pattern di attività neurale più discriminanti per specifiche condizioni, come demenza o disturbi dell'apprendimento. Questo non solo migliora la precisione diagnostica, ma può anche fornire indizi sui meccanismi neurali sottostanti.
La sfida principale risiede nell'integrare questi approcci quantitativi con la ricchezza delle osservazioni cliniche qualitative. Tuttavia, le opportunità di migliorare la nostra comprensione del cervello e di sviluppare interventi più efficaci sono immense.
L'uso di tecniche avanzate come le manifold, che sfruttano l'IA per visualizzare e analizzare dati complessi, sta ulteriormente ampliando le frontiere di questo campo.
La robustezza come pilastro della ricerca scientifica
Nel rigoroso processo della ricerca scientifica, la robustezza dei metodi analitici è un requisito non negoziabile. Nei dati biomedici, la presenza di rumore, artefatti e variabili confondenti può facilmente portare a conclusioni errate.
Un metodo di selezione delle feature robusto, come quello implementato in ROOFS, garantisce che i risultati ottenuti non siano semplicemente il prodotto di specifiche peculiarità del dataset analizzato, ma riflettano pattern biologici reali e generalizzabili. Questo principio è fondamentale per la validità e l'affidabilità delle scoperte scientifiche.
Senza robustezza, i biomarcatori identificati potrebbero non essere riproducibili in altri laboratori o popolazioni di pazienti, vanificando gli sforzi di ricerca e sviluppo. L'attenzione alla robustezza implica anche la considerazione di potenziali fattori confondenti non osservati, che possono distorcere le relazioni tra variabili.
Affrontare queste sfide metodologiche è essenziale per costruire una base di conoscenza scientifica solida e affidabile, capace di guidare progressi concreti nella diagnosi e nel trattamento delle malattie.
Il futuro della selezione delle feature nei dati biomedici
Il futuro della selezione delle feature nei dati biomedici è intrinsecamente legato ai progressi nell'Intelligenza Artificiale e nel machine learning. Pacchetti come ROOFS rappresentano solo l'inizio di una nuova era di analisi dati più sofisticate e potenti.
Ci aspettiamo di vedere lo sviluppo di algoritmi ancora più capaci di gestire la complessità crescente dei dati, integrando informazioni da fonti eterogenee e fornendo insight predittivi sempre più accurati. L'enfasi sulla robustezza rimarrà centrale, poiché la traslazione dei risultati dalla ricerca alla clinica dipende dalla loro affidabilità.
Inoltre, la crescente disponibilità di grandi dataset biomedici, unita alla potenza computazionale, permetterà di addestrare modelli sempre più performanti. La sfida sarà quella di mantenere l'interpretabilità di questi modelli complessi, assicurando che i ricercatori e i clinici possano comprendere e fidarsi delle raccomandazioni fornite dagli algoritmi.
La collaborazione tra neuroscienziati, clinici e data scientist sarà fondamentale per guidare questa evoluzione e massimizzare il potenziale trasformativo dell'IA nella medicina e nella neuropsicologia.
Domande Frequenti
Risposte rapide alle domande più comuni sull' articolo: roofs svela i segreti dei dati biomedici complessi.
Cos'è ROOFS e a cosa serve?
ROOFS è un pacchetto Python progettato per la selezione robusta di feature (caratteristiche) in dataset biomedici ad alta dimensionalità. Il suo scopo principale è identificare le variabili più informative per la ricerca di biomarcatori, ma i suoi principi sono applicabili anche in altri contesti di analisi dati complessi.
Quali sono i vantaggi di usare ROOFS rispetto ad altri metodi?
ROOFS si distingue per la sua robustezza, ovvero la capacità di fornire risultati affidabili anche in presenza di rumore, outlier o dati mancanti nei dataset. Questo garantisce una maggiore generalizzabilità e affidabilità delle feature selezionate rispetto a metodi più sensibili.
In che modo ROOFS può essere utile nella neuropsicologia?
Nella neuropsicologia, ROOFS può aiutare a identificare quali test o misure cognitive sono più predittivi di specifiche condizioni neurologiche o psichiatriche. Questo supporta una diagnosi più accurata dei deficit cognitivi e la comprensione dei meccanismi cerebrali sottostanti.
È necessario avere competenze avanzate di programmazione per usare ROOFS?
Essendo un pacchetto Python, richiede una conoscenza di base della programmazione in Python. Tuttavia, è progettato per essere integrato nei workflow di analisi esistenti, rendendolo accessibile a ricercatori e data scientist con familiarità con l'ambiente Python.
Quali tipi di dati biomedici sono più adatti per ROOFS?
ROOFS è particolarmente indicato per dati biomedici ad alta dimensionalità, come quelli provenienti da genomica, proteomica, trascrittomica, o dati clinici con un gran numero di variabili. È efficace anche quando il numero di feature supera il numero di campioni.
Come si collega ROOFS al concetto di 'confounders non osservati'?
La robustezza intrinseca di ROOFS aiuta a mitigare l'impatto di variabili confondenti, sia osservate che potenzialmente non osservate. Selezionando feature che mantengono la loro rilevanza predittiva in diverse condizioni, si riduce il rischio che le associazioni scoperte siano spurie o dovute a fattori esterni non controllati.
